This concert, recorded live at the Rialto Theater in Atlanta, was produced by Constantine Commercial Carpets. The Star of the show is Joe Gransden. His singing and trumpet playing have been acclaimed throughout the country as he has performed in New York, California, The Southeast and most of the metropolitan areas in America as well as in Europe. His vocal and trumpet styles have been compared favorably to Chet Baker but they are really uniquely Joe's.
They are totally original and have a unique melodic quality. Joe has previously recorded four CD'S with his trio or quartet. This is his first CD with a big band.
